Carrying Out Thorough Situation Investigations



To efficiently represent your clients, conduct a detailed investigation of the situation. This is crucial in building a solid defense technique and uncovering any evidence that might sustain your customer's virtue or alleviate their fees.

Beginning by assessing all readily available papers, such as police reports, witness declarations, and forensic reports. Meeting witnesses, both the prosecution's and your very own, to gather additional information or determine variances.

Visit the crime scene to gain a far better understanding of the scenarios surrounding the case. Consult with experts, such as forensic professionals or private investigators, to aid in assessing evidence or locating potential witnesses.

Additionally, discover any possible lawful problems or constitutional violations that might affect the instance. By carrying out a thorough examination, you can reveal critical information and develop a compelling protection technique that gives your client the best possibility at a positive end result.

Structure a Solid Defense Strategy



One of the essential steps in building a solid defense strategy is performing a thorough examination to collect all appropriate evidence. As a criminal defense lawyer, it's crucial for you to leave no stone unturned in your mission for details.

This entails assessing police records, witness declarations, and any other readily available documents connected to the case. In addition, you may need to speak with prospective witnesses, visit the criminal activity scene, and consult with specialists in pertinent areas.

By gathering all the required proof, you'll have the ability to determine any kind of weak points in the prosecution's situation and create a solid protection strategy.

Navigating the Challenges of Interrogation

One obstacle you might run into is a hostile witness that's uncooperative or combative. In such a situation, it is essential to preserve your composure and remain focused on the facts.

One more obstacle is dealing with incredibly elusive witnesses who attempt to stay clear of addressing your concerns directly. To overcome this, you can rephrase your concerns or existing inconsistent evidence to catch the witness.

In addition, you may deal with arguments from the opposing advise during interrogation. It's essential to prepare for prospective objections and be prepared with convincing disagreements to counter them.
